Transaction 789e44516d64498441ffaeb22bc6830d144e40cdb1d62d956cb28cffdf62d3de

1 Input
2 Outputs
  • 789e44516d64498441ffaeb22bc6830d144e40cdb1d62d956cb28cffdf62d3de:0
  • value  595918
    address  19qEaQmThd6MCaAFynLfCvmReqrXysJzZC
  • 789e44516d64498441ffaeb22bc6830d144e40cdb1d62d956cb28cffdf62d3de:1
  • value  512926
    address  31h27qK9nJg3wWXLmZ9Twek7XvYPfaswXh